Company overview
Reliability Incorporated, through its subsidiary The Maslow Media Group, Inc., delivers comprehensive workforce solutions to clients across the United States and internationally. The company's operations are divided into four primary segments: Employer of Record, Recruiting and Staffing, Video and Multimedia Production, and Permanent Placements. The Employer of Record (EoR) division manages a variety of human resources tasks, such as state employment registration, employee onboarding and offboarding, payroll processing, benefits package administration, workers' compensation claim handling, employee relations, regulatory compliance, and on-site workforce management. This also includes overseeing compliance with state, county, and city-mandated benefits like paid safe and sick leave. Its Recruiting and Staffing arm focuses on providing solutions for on-demand or short-term staffing requirements, contract placements, and administrative support for on-site management. The Video and Multimedia Production segment offers end-to-end services, starting with pre-production activities such as video conceptualization, project consulting, and budget development and oversight. It handles the logistical coordination for both field and studio teams, supplying broadcast-level HD camera crews for on-location support, complete with makeup artists, AV technicians, field producers, and full equipment rental. Post-production services include access to facilities and freelance professionals like non-linear editors, graphic artists, narrators, and actors. Additionally, the segment creates animation and graphic designs, including whiteboard animation, provides live transmission services via satellite and streaming, and manages fully equipped client studios. Lastly, the Permanent Placements segment specializes in identifying and filling a wide array of full-time roles for its clientele. In addition to these core offerings, Reliability Incorporated provides critical resources for information technology industries, including quality assurance analysts, engineers, testers, developers, business systems analysts, and research and development specialists. The company serves diverse sectors such as media, banking, medical devices, pharmaceuticals, telecommunications, energy, healthcare, photography, and chain restaurants. Reliability Incorporated was founded in 1988 and maintains its headquarters in Clarksburg, Maryland.
